Implementing Robust Security Measures

Securing sensitive information is as important as organizing it. Companies must adopt multi-layered security protocols, including encryption, access controls, and regular monitoring. By ensuring data integrity, businesses protect themselves from cyber threats, regulatory penalties, and reputational damage. An effective security framework also fosters trust with clients and partners, demonstrating a commitment to responsible data management practices. Regularly updating security policies in line with emerging threats ensures ongoing protection and mitigates risks before they escalate into critical issues.

Monitoring and Maintaining Data Quality

Maintaining high-quality data is an ongoing process. Companies should implement routine checks and audits to verify accuracy, completeness, and consistency. Tools that automate data validation can detect errors before they become systemic issues, reducing risks and improving reliability. Consistent monitoring also helps identify outdated information, ensuring that teams base decisions on the most current and relevant data available. Organizations that prioritize data hygiene often see improved analytics results, more precise forecasting, and stronger customer insights.
